Elected Mayor of North Tyneside

Since my election in June 2009 I have been working hard to deliver the promises I made to you on the issues that you told me were important to you as residents.

You will no doubt have read a great deal in the press about my 2010/2011 Council Plan and Budget.

My key priority as the Elected Mayor of North Tyneside is to reduce this Council's reliance on borrowing and ensure a stable future for North Tyneside. In order to achieve this, I have introduced a number of measures including substantial reductions in unsecured borrowing and reliance on reserves. At the same time I have been able to set the lowest Council Tax since 1995.
